In the video captioning methods based on an encoder-decoder,limited visual features are extracted by an encoder,and a natural sentence of the video content is generated using a decoder.However,this kind ofmethod is dependent on a single video input source and few visual labels,and there is a problem with semantic alignment between video contents and generated natural sentences,which are not suitable for accurately comprehending and describing the video contents.To address this issue,this paper proposes a video captioning method by semantic topic-guided generation.First,a 3D convolutional neural network is utilized to extract the spatiotemporal features of videos during the encoding.Then,the semantic topics of video data are extracted using the visual labels retrieved from similar video data.In the decoding,a decoder is constructed by combining a novel Enhance-TopK sampling algorithm with a Generative Pre-trained Transformer-2 deep neural network,which decreases the influence of“deviation”in the semantic mapping process between videos and texts by jointly decoding a baseline and semantic topics of video contents.During this process,the designed Enhance-TopK sampling algorithm can alleviate a long-tail problem by dynamically adjusting the probability distribution of the predicted words.Finally,the experiments are conducted on two publicly used Microsoft Research Video Description andMicrosoft Research-Video to Text datasets.The experimental results demonstrate that the proposed method outperforms several state-of-art approaches.Specifically,the performance indicators Bilingual Evaluation Understudy,Metric for Evaluation of Translation with Explicit Ordering,Recall Oriented Understudy for Gisting Evaluation-longest common subsequence,and Consensus-based Image Description Evaluation of the proposed method are improved by 1.2%,0.1%,0.3%,and 2.4% on the Microsoft Research Video Description dataset,and 0.1%,1.0%,0.1%,and 2.8% on the Microsoft Research-Video to Text dataset,respectively,compared with the existing video captioning methods.As a result,the proposed method can generate video captioning that is more closely aligned with human natural language expression habits. 展开更多

AIM:To provide a detailed description of the natural history of persistent subretinal fluid(SRF)after successful repair of rhegmatogenous retinal detachment(RRD)and its association with visual outcome.METHODS:This was a prospective long-term follow-up for eyes undergoing scleral buckling(SB)surgery for maculaoff RRD.Examinations were carried out preoperatively and postoperatively at 1,3,6,9 and 12 mo,until persistent SRF had completely resolved.One month postoperatively,optical coherence tomography(OCT)was used to classify SRF into three patterns:bleb-like loculated(BL),shallow-diffused(SD),and multiple blebs(MB).Serial OCT imaging was used to evaluate morphological changes in SRF until its complete disappearance.Patients were divided into two groups depending on the presence or absence of persistent SRF.RESULTS:A total of 59 patients(59 eyes)were included.There were no statistical differences between two groups at baseline,except for the proportion of patients with high myopia and a younger age.One month after surgery,OCT detected persistent SRF in 49 eyes(83.1%).The 3 morphological patterns of SRF were observed in 27 eyes(55.1%)with BL,13 eyes(26.5%)with SD,and 9 eyes(18.4%)with MB.The mean time for complete absorption differed significantly across the three SRF patterns(F=8.097,P=0.001),which was 8.8±6.1,20.1±12.1,and 16.7±10.2 mo in BL,SD,and MB,respectively.In 9 of the 13 eyes with SD,the pattern transformed into MB type.In cases involving MB,the size and number of blebs decreased gradually until they had been completely absorbed.Eyes with persistent SRF were more likely to demonstrate disruption of the ellipsoid zone(49.0%vs 10%,P=0.034).The final best-corrected visual acuity of two groups was 0.37±0.11(with SRF)vs 0.34±0.12(without SRF)logMAR(P=0.499),respectively.CONCLUSION:High preoperative myopia and younger age are associated with persistent SRF.BL is the most commonly observed pattern with the shortest duration and gradually disappeared.Most cases involving SD SRF transform into MB type during resolution.The size and number of the MBs decrease gradually until they were completely absorbed.The absence of persistent SRF may contribute to slow visual recovery in the short-term but does not influence the final visual outcome. 展开更多

Currently,the video captioning models based on an encoder-decoder mainly rely on a single video input source.The contents of video captioning are limited since few studies employed external corpus information to guide the generation of video captioning,which is not conducive to the accurate descrip-tion and understanding of video content.To address this issue,a novel video captioning method guided by a sentence retrieval generation network(ED-SRG)is proposed in this paper.First,a ResNeXt network model,an efficient convolutional network for online video understanding(ECO)model,and a long short-term memory(LSTM)network model are integrated to construct an encoder-decoder,which is utilized to extract the 2D features,3D features,and object features of video data respectively.These features are decoded to generate textual sentences that conform to video content for sentence retrieval.Then,a sentence-transformer network model is employed to retrieve different sentences in an external corpus that are semantically similar to the above textual sentences.The candidate sentences are screened out through similarity measurement.Finally,a novel GPT-2 network model is constructed based on GPT-2 network structure.The model introduces a designed random selector to randomly select predicted words with a high probability in the corpus,which is used to guide and generate textual sentences that are more in line with human natural language expressions.The proposed method in this paper is compared with several existing works by experiments.The results show that the indicators BLEU-4,CIDEr,ROUGE_L,and METEOR are improved by 3.1%,1.3%,0.3%,and 1.5%on a public dataset MSVD and 1.3%,0.5%,0.2%,1.9%on a public dataset MSR-VTT respectively.It can be seen that the proposed method in this paper can generate video captioning with richer semantics than several state-of-the-art approaches. 展开更多

时空图被广泛应用于行人轨迹预测等时间序列任务中,如何更精确地捕捉不同时间段的轨迹位置信息以及更充分地利用时空图的结构信息对于轨迹预测至关重要。传统的轨迹预测方法规则复杂、约束性强、可扩展性较差,往往只能应用于特定领域。... 时空图被广泛应用于行人轨迹预测等时间序列任务中,如何更精确地捕捉不同时间段的轨迹位置信息以及更充分地利用时空图的结构信息对于轨迹预测至关重要。传统的轨迹预测方法规则复杂、约束性强、可扩展性较差,往往只能应用于特定领域。基于学习的轨迹预测方法不依赖于专家经验的物理规则,根据观察的轨迹数据来学习不同时间段各个空间位置之间的变化规则。基于学习的方法存在一定局限性,如没有充分利用时空图的结构信息,导致轨迹预测模型的性能下降。针对上述问题,提出了一种新型基于时空图联合关系路径的行人轨迹预测框架(Spatio-Temporal Graphs with Relationship Path Trajectory Prediction Framework, STRP-TPF)。STRP-TPF主要包括EdgeRNN和NodeRNN模型。STRP-TPF基于时空图构建关系路径,基于关系路径构建因子图;构建EdgeRNN和NodeRNN模型,并将因子图作为输入;输出下一时刻行人的位置,并且预测完整的行人轨迹。STRP-TPF利用关系路径能够准确捕捉时空图的结构信息,充分学习行人在不同时间和空间点的轨迹关系。大量实验结果表明,在ETH和UCY数据集上,STRP-TPF的整体性能均优于目前最先进的方法。在平均位移误差和最终位移误差方面,STRP-TPF比目前最先进方法低32.6%和37.7%。STRP-TPF的预测轨迹能够更准确地匹配真实轨迹。 展开更多

目的:探讨玻璃体切割(PPV)术后成功复位的孔源性视网膜脱离(RRD)患者发生视物变形的危险因素。方法:回顾性临床研究。纳入2017-01/2019-01在我院确诊的RRD患者94例94眼进行研究。所有患者均行经睫状体平坦部标准23G PPV手术。首次PPV后... 目的:探讨玻璃体切割(PPV)术后成功复位的孔源性视网膜脱离(RRD)患者发生视物变形的危险因素。方法:回顾性临床研究。纳入2017-01/2019-01在我院确诊的RRD患者94例94眼进行研究。所有患者均行经睫状体平坦部标准23G PPV手术。首次PPV后视网膜解剖复位。于PPV术前及术后1、6、12mo,至末次随访,行BCVA、眼压、裂隙灯显微镜、间接检眼镜、视物变形评分表(M-chart表)、OCT检查,并分析发生视物变形的危险因素。结果:术后1mo,94眼中50眼(53%)存在视物变形,视物变形(+)组平均M值为0.68±0.28,累及黄斑和未累及黄斑的RRD患者发生视物变形有差异(P<0.01),术后不同随访时间M值变化有差异(F=26.442,P<0.01)。多因素Logistic回归分析结果显示:视网膜脱离累及黄斑(OR=9.020,95%CI:1.808~45.011,P=0.007)、EZ完整性中断(OR=10.570,95%CI:2.909~38.400,P<0.01)是RRD复位术后视物变形发生的独立影响因素。结论:PPV术后成功复位的RRD患者术后发生视物变形程度逐渐减轻,视网膜脱离累及黄斑和EZ完整性中断是发生视物变形的独立危险因素。 展开更多

灰狼优化算法(GWO)是一种新的基于灰狼捕食行为的元启发式算法,被证明是一种具有高水平的探索和开发能力的算法。但是存在开发和探索不平衡的问题,以至于其优化性能并不理想。该文将混沌理论引入GWO中,用于平衡GWO的探索和开发,提出一... 灰狼优化算法(GWO)是一种新的基于灰狼捕食行为的元启发式算法,被证明是一种具有高水平的探索和开发能力的算法。但是存在开发和探索不平衡的问题,以至于其优化性能并不理想。该文将混沌理论引入GWO中,用于平衡GWO的探索和开发,提出一种改进的混沌灰狼优化算法(CGWO),并应用于多层感知器(MLPs)的训练。首先,基于Cubic混沌理论对GWO的位置更新公式进行改进,以增加个体的多样性,增大跳出局部最优的概率和对解空间进行深入的搜索;其次,设计一种非线性收敛因子,用于协调和平衡CGWO算法在不同迭代进化时期的探索和开发能力;最后,将CGWO算法作为MLPs的训练器,用于对3个复杂分类问题进行分类实验。结果表明:CGWO在分类准确率,避免陷入局部最优,全局收敛速度和鲁棒性方面相较于其他对比算法均具有较好的性能。 展开更多

AIM: To study the role of immature dendritic cells (imDCs) on immune tolerance in rat penetrating keratoplasty (PKP) in high -risk eyes and to investigate the mechanism of immune hyporesponsiveness induced by donor-derived imDCs. ·METHODS: Seventy-five SD rats (recipient) and 39 Wistar rats (donor) were randomly divided into 3 groups: control, imDC and mature dendritic cell (mDC) group respectively. Using a model of orthotopic corneal transplantation in which allografts were placed in neovascularized high -risk eyes of recipient rat. Corneal neovascularization was induced by alkaline burn in the central cornea of recipient rat. Recipients in imDC group or mDC group were injected donor bone marrow-derived imDCs or mDCs of 1 ×10 6 respectively 1 week before corneal transplantation via tail vein. Control rat received the same volume of PBS. In each group, 16 recipients were kept for determination of survival time and other 9 recipients were executed on day 3, 7 and 14 after transplantation. Cornea was harvested for hematoxylin - eosin staining and acute rejection evaluation, Western blot was used to detect the expression level of Foxp3. ·RESULTS: The mean survival time of imDC group was significantly longer than that of control and mDC groups (all P <0.05). The expression level of Foxp3 on CD4 + CD25 + T cells of imDC group (2.24 ±0.18) was significantly higher than that in the control (1.68 ±0.09) and mDC groups (1.46±0.13) (all P <0.05).·CONCLUSION: Donor -derived imDC is an effective treatment in inducing immune hyporesponsiveness in rat PKP. The mechanism of immune tolerance induced by imDC might be inhibit T lymphocytes responsiveness by regulatory T cells. 展开更多

After binding to the estrogen receptor, estrogen can alleviate the toxic effects of beta-amyloid protein, and thereby exert a therapeutic effect on Alzheimer's disease patients. Estrogen can increase the incidence of breast carcinoma and endometrial cancer in post-menopausal women, so it is not suitable for clinical treatment of Alzheimer's disease. There is recent evidence that the estrogen receptor can exert its neuroprotective effects without estrogen dependence. Real-time quantitative PCR and flow cytometry results showed that, compared with non-transfected PC12 cells, adenovirus-mediated estrogen receptor β gene-transfected PC12 cells exhibited lower expression of tumor necrosis factor α and interleukin 1β under stimulation with beta-amyloid protein and stronger protection from apoptosis. The Akt-specific inhibitor Abi-2 decreased the anti-inflammatory and anti-apoptotic effects of estrogen receptor β gene-transfection. These findings suggest that overexpression of estrogen receptor β can alleviate the toxic effect of beta-amyloid protein on PC12 cells, without estrogen dependence. The Akt pathway is one of the potential means for the anti-inflammatory and anti-apoptotic effects of the estrogen receptor. 展开更多

Background:Endostatin(ES) is a well-established potent endogenous antiangiogenic factor.An ES variant,called zinc-binding protein-ES(ZBP-ES),is clinically available;however,its use is limited by rapid renal clearance and short residence time.PEGylation has been exploited to overcome these shortcomings,and mono-PEGylated ES(called M_2ES) as well as mono-PEGylated ZBP-ES(MZBP-ES) are developed in our study.This study aimed to compare the biophysical properties and biological effects of M_2ES and MZBP-ES to evaluate their druggability.Methods:Circular dichroism and tryptophan emission fluorescence were used to monitor the conformational changes of M_2ES and MZBP-ES.Their resistance to trypsin digestion and guanidinium chloride(GdmCl)-induced unfolding was examined by Coomassie staining and tryptophan emission fluorescence,respectively.The biological effects of M_2ES and MZBP-ES on endothelial cell migration were evaluated using Transwell migration and wound healing assays,and the uptake of M_2ES and MZBP-ES in endothelial cells was also compared by Western blotting and immunofluorescence.Results:Structural analyses revealed that M_2ES has a more compact tertiary structure than MZBP-ES.Moreover,M_2ES was more resistant to trypsin digestion and GdmCI-induced unfolding compared with MZBP-ES.In addition,although M_2ES and MZBP-ES showed comparable levels of inhibiting transwell migration and wound healing of endothelial cells,M_2ES displayed an increased ability to enter cells compared with MZBP-ES,possibly caused by the enhanced interaction with nucleolin.Conclusions:M_2ES has a more compact tertiary structure,is more stable for trypsin digestion and GdmCI-induced unfolding,exhibits increased cellular uptake and shows equivalent inhibitory effects on cell migration relative to MZBP-ES,indicating that M_2ES is a more promising candidate for anticancer drug development compared with MZBP-ES. 展开更多

AIM:To explore the protective effects of amino-guanidine(AG) on retinal apoptosis in mice with oxygeninduced retinopathy(OIR).·METHODS:A total of 80 C57BL/6J mice,aged 7 days,were randomly divided into four groups:normal,high oxygen,high oxygen saline and high oxygen treated with AG.In the normal group,mice were housed in normoxic conditions from postnatal day P7 to P17.Mice in the other 3 groups were placed under hyperoxic conditions(75 ±2% O2) in an oxygen-regulated chamber for 5 days and subsequently placed in normoxic conditions for 5days.Mice in the AG group were treated once daily,from P12 to P17,with AG hemisulfate(100mg/kg body weight,intraperitoneally) dissolved in physiological saline.An equivalent amount of 0.9% physiological saline was administered,as above,to mice in the high oxygen saline group.Ten mice were randomly selected from each group on P14 and on P17,euthanized and the retinas examined.Apoptotic cells in the retina were detected using the terminal-deoxynucleoitidyl transferase mediated nick end labeling(TUNEL) method.The expression of nitric oxide synthase(iNOS) in the retina was detected by immunohistochemistry and changes in rod cells were observed using electron microscopy.·RESULTS:TUNEL-positive cells and iNOS immunoreactive neurons were present in the inner nuclear and ganglion cell retinal layers of mice in the high oxygen group.The number of TUNEL-positive cells was significantly greater in the high oxygen group compared with the normal group(t =-20.81,P14d<0.05;t =-15.05,P17d<0.05).However,the number of TUNEL-positive cells in the AG treatment group was significantly lower(t =-13.21,P14d<0.05;t =-6.61,P17d<0.05) compared with thehigh oxygen group.The expression of iNOS was significantly higher in the high oxygen group compared with the normal group(t =-21.95,P14d<0.05;t =-17.30,P17d<0.05).However,the expression of iNOS in the AG treatment group was significantly lower(t =-12.17,P14d<0.05;t =-10.30,P17d<0.05) compared with the high oxygen group.The outer segments of the rods were disorganized and short in the high oxygen group.Rod morphology appeared to be slightly improved in the AG group.·CONCLUSION:AG may protect retinal neurons in OIR by inhibiting apoptosis.The mechanism may be related to iNOS. 展开更多

AIM:To assess the protective effect of human umbilical cord mesenchymal stem cell exosomes(hucMSC-Exs)in a diabetic rat model by using a variety of retinal bioassays.METHODS:hucMSCs were subjected to differential ultracentrifugation for the collection of exosomes,and transmission electron microscopy(TEM),nanoparticle tracking analysis(NTA)using a NanoSight analysis system and Western blotting(WB)were used to analyze the expression of surface marker proteins such as CD63,CD9 and Calnexin.Streptozotocin(STZ)was injected into the intraperitoneal cavity to establish a diabetic model.Rats were divided into a normal group,diabetic group and hucMSC-Ex group.Fundus fluorescein angiography(FFA),optical coherence tomography(OCT)and other live imaging methods were used to observe the fundus of the rats.Finally,the eyeballs of rats from each group were collected for hematoxylin-eosin(HE)staining to further analyze the retinal structure.RESULTS:Through TEM,NTA and WB,we successfully isolated hucMSC-Exs.Subsequent FFA and OCT confirmed that hucMSC-Exs effectively prevented early retinal vascular damage and thickening of the retina.Finally,HE staining of rat retinal sections revealed that exosomes effectively alleviated retinal structure disruption caused by diabetes.CONCLUSION:hucMSC-Exs have a protective effect on the retina in diabetic rat through FFA,OCT and HE staining. 展开更多

试验旨在研究蛋白水平日变化饲粮对仔猪生长性能及养分表观消化率的影响。试验配制3种能量水平相近、粗蛋白质水平分别为17.0%、18.5%和20.0%的仔猪饲粮。选用21日龄体型体况相似、健康状况良好、平均体重为(6.95±0.06)kg的仔猪90... 试验旨在研究蛋白水平日变化饲粮对仔猪生长性能及养分表观消化率的影响。试验配制3种能量水平相近、粗蛋白质水平分别为17.0%、18.5%和20.0%的仔猪饲粮。选用21日龄体型体况相似、健康状况良好、平均体重为(6.95±0.06)kg的仔猪90头,随机分为3组。对照组全天饲喂蛋白水平为18.5%的饲粮,试验1组早、中、晚分别饲喂蛋白水平为20.0%、18.5%和17.0%的饲粮,试验2组早、中、晚分别饲喂蛋白水平为17.0%、18.5%和20.0%的饲粮。试验期30 d。结果表明:试验1组仔猪平均日增重较对照组提高4.7%,采食量比对照组提高4.7%;试验1组与试验2组仔猪腹泻率分别降低1.63%和0.92%,差异均不显著(P>0.05);与对照组相比,试验1组和试验2组各项营养指标的表观消化率均有提高,试验1组粗蛋白质和粗脂肪的表观消化率显著提高(P<0.05)。结果表明,依据仔猪自身生物节律为仔猪早、中、晚分别提供20.0%、18.5%和17.0%蛋白水平的饲粮可提高其生长性能,降低腹泻发生率,并对营养物质消化产生积极作用。 展开更多
